Corruption in the public sector can have a detrimental effect on all ministries and departments including healthcare, transport, education, welfare, and environmental protection. This paper focuses on the behavioural side of addressing corruption: how can we motivate public officials to join us in effectively preventing and countering corruption? It suggests that to promote public sector effectiveness and integrity, governments of Pacific Island Countries should aim to understand and influence behavioural norms and intrinsically and extrinsically motivate public officials through rewards and consequences.

This publication was prepared by the United Nations Pacific Regional Anti-Corruption (UN-PRAC) Project, a joint initiative by the United Nations Office on Drugs and Crime (UNODC) and United Nations Development Programme (UNDP), supported by the New Zealand Aid Programme.
